Development of a Discharge Sensing Technique for Electrical Assets Ageing Prediction

Electrical power assets such as generators, transmission lines, transformers and other equipment are designed to function for 10s of years. Maintenance is crucial to ensure continued operation and this maintenance is preferred before any failure occurs. Degradation of components can be identified from many features before failure. This project investigates different types of discharge (such are partial discharge, surface discharge) and classifies them, investigates standard techniques to monitor discharges and develops a novel no-contact technique.
